我已經使用Angular 2 CLI構建了我的Angular 2項目,並能夠使用此tutorial將應用程序部署到Heroku。Heroku管道與Angular 2環境
現在,我想爲應用程序的不同環境(dev,staging,production等)創建一個管道。
在我的package.json中,我有"postinstall": "ng build -prod"
,它創建了我的代碼的生產版本,這是我的應用程序運行的。有沒有一種方法可以根據CONFIG_VARS
更改-prod
,這在我的Heroku設置中會有?例如,對於開發環境來說,它會說"postinstall": "ng build -dev"
,或者對於分段環境來說"postinstall": "ng build -staging"
。或者我需要設置不同的項目?
謝謝你的回答。所以爲了確保我理解正確,我將無法利用Angular CLI爲我設定的環境。 – Dauzy
不像你在你的問題中建議的那樣,沒有。 –
嗨@YoniRabinovitch我面臨同樣的問題,並問[關於實施服務器[問題](https://stackoverflow.com/questions/46824209/firebase-angular-4-initialize-based-on-node-environment)在Angular 4中查詢環境,請你幫忙 – ishaqbhojani